Based in Lusaka, Zambia, Lusaka International Community School (LICS) is a co-educational, secular, fee-paying, non-profit school that provides an internationally recognised education to a culturally diverse, globally minded student body in a caring and supportive learning environment. LICS holds in high esteem its vision statement, which is to “maximise the potential of future world citizens”.

LICS is a leading independent Pre-Primary, Primary, and Secondary School based in the leafy suburb of Roma in Lusaka, Zambia, and is a member of CIS, AISA, and ISAZ.

Responsibilities or duties

  • Plan, deliver, and assess engaging lessons aligned with the Cambridge Primary Curriculum.
  • Monitor and report on student progress through detailed assessments and reports.
  • Set and mark homework in line with school policies.
  • Ensure classrooms are stimulating with up-to-date student work displays.
  • Promote student well-being and maintain discipline according to school policies.
  • Safeguard the health and safety of students at all times.
  • Provide guidance on educational, social, and emotional matters.
  • Engage with parents and the school community to support student success.
  • Participate in performance appraisals and ongoing professional development.
  • Embrace and integrate technology into teaching practices.
  • Mentor and support other staff as required.
  • Attend assemblies, community events, and parent-teacher meetings.
  • Actively promote the school’s vision, mission, and dress code policies.
  • Collaborate with leadership teams to develop teaching materials and curriculum plans.
  • Coordinate with pre-primary and secondary teachers for smooth student transitions.
  • Participate in staff meetings and school-wide planning sessions.
  • Ensure that all the students in their assigned class follow the same curriculum as the parallel class.
  • Ensure progress in preparation for the next phase of the curriculum.
  • Be aware of the PS goals and areas of focus and actively promote these to achieve success.

Qualifications or requirements (e.g., education, skills)

  • IT proficiency, including knowledge of Microsoft Office Suite and educational applications
  • Interest in innovative practices, including the integration of AI in education
  • Team-oriented with excellent interpersonal skills
  • Demonstrated understanding of student learning needs and curriculum delivery
  • Ability to create a safe, inclusive, and stimulating classroom environment
  • Commitment to the school’s mission, vision, and community values
  • Actively promote ‘Global Citizenship’ in the everyday classroom and around campus
  • Proven ability to write progress reports on students
  • Committed to keeping up to date with educational developments
  • Bachelor’s degree, QTS, PGCE, or equivalent qualification in primary education.

Experience needed

  • At least 3 years of teaching experience in KS1 and/or KS2
